6 funeral rituals
-body washed
-body wrapped in white cloth
-body buried
-body laid facing Mecca
-earth above grave raised
-grave unmarked/simple
why is the body washed (funeral ritual)?
made clean before standing in front of Allah for judgement
why is body wrapped in white cloth (funeral ritual)?
represents purity & equality as all buried in same clothing
why is body buried (funeral ritual)?
we are made from earth, so should return to earth
why is body laid facing Mecca (funeral ritual)?
even after death, facing ‘house of Allah’
why is earth above grave raised (funeral ritual)?
so people don’t walk on it by accident
why is grave unmarked/simple (funeral ritual)?
not place of worship, treated equally
what happens after death?
-angel of death takes soul from body
-munkar & nakir ask 3 questions:
->correctly = soul move into nice sleep
->incorrectly = soul will feel fear
-soul enters state of waiting for Judgement Day
What will happen at end of world?
-Israfil blows trumpet, blinding light earth destroyed 🎺
-Messiah come to earth & fight fake prophets ⚔️
-Heaven created ☁️
-After 40 days, trumpet blown again 🎺
-everybody who has ever lived, resurrected by Allah 🧍🧍♀️🧍♂️
-> body & soul reuniting 🧍♀️+ 👻
-each person handed ‘book of life’ 📖
-Allah judges them 👨⚖️
-Allah sort souls by commanding to cross Sirat Bridge (built over Jahhanam) 🌉
-good = cross bridge ☁️
-bad = fall to hell🔥
